Plants
Indoor plants are an amazing accessory to have in the office. Not only to look like an indoor jungle, but also to reap the health benefits! Plants at work really help to remove toxins and harmful compounds from the air around them, breathing fresh new oxygen into all around us! A subtle way to boost the mood.. add some green!Stationery
Let’s be honest, rummaging through a desk drawer full of rubbish desperately trying to find a piece of scrap paper is frustrating. It can also hinder the *obviously amazing* idea we had in the first place! Laying out useful and practical stationery at arm’s length will mean that no idea goes missing. Also… colour coordinating and rose gold accents will never go astray.
Natural light
Exposure to natural light has been directly linked to better workplace performance*. (We really do our research!) 35% of employees instantly identify an absence of natural light as a major concern of their office environment. This results in feelings of isolation, tension and frustration, none of which are wanted at work! If your building is really lacking in windows, make sure to schedule in some outdoor fresh-air time every couple of hours!

Do indoor plants really help in an office?Yes. Indoor plants help remove some toxins from the air and add fresh oxygen, and greenery is a simple way to lift the mood at a desk. Low-maintenance varieties such as succulents or a peace lily are easy choices for people who travel or forget to water. They soften a hard office layout and make the space feel calmer.
Why does natural light matter at work?Exposure to natural light has been linked to better workplace performance, and many employees rate a lack of it as a real concern about their office. Poor light can leave people feeling isolated and tense. If your building is short on windows, schedule short outdoor breaks every couple of hours to reset.
What stationery should I keep on my desk?Keep the practical items you reach for most: pens, sticky notes, a notepad, and a small organiser so nothing gets lost in a cluttered drawer. Having useful stationery laid out within arm's reach means a good idea never slips away while you hunt for paper. Coordinated colours are a nice bonus but not essential.
